About the trial
Head and neck squamous cell carcinoma (HNSCC) presents a significant clinical challenge, as over 60% of patients are diagnosed at a locally advanced stage with a high risk of recurrence. Although the landmark KEYNOTE-689 trial established neoadjuvant immune checkpoint inhibitor (ICI) therapy as a new standard of care, the pathological complete response (pCR) rate remains unsatisfactory at only 3.0%, highlighting an urgent need for optimized combination strategies. This prospective, single-arm, single-center clinical study aims to evaluate the safety, tolerability, and preliminary efficacy of a novel neoadjuvant and adjuvant regimen combining an engineered mitochondrial vaccine (IMP3-Mito) with ICIs for patients with resectable, IMP3-positive locally advanced HNSCC. The rationale is based on a "Prime-and-Release" synergistic mechanism: the engineered mitochondrial vaccine serves as a potent "natural adjuvant" to activate dendritic cells and prime tumor-specific T-cell responses against the IMP3 antigen, while the ICI subsequently releases the immune brakes within the tumor microenvironment. By integrating these two modalities, the study seeks to achieve deeper pathological responses and improve long-term survival, while simultaneously providing clinical evidence for the transformative potential of the mitochondrial engineering platform in overcoming the limitations of conventional tumor vaccines.
